首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Lua -获取嵌套表格元素

Lua是一种轻量级的脚本语言,被广泛应用于游戏开发、嵌入式系统和服务器端开发等领域。它具有简洁、高效、易学的特点,被称为"胶水语言",可以方便地与其他语言进行集成。

在Lua中,可以使用索引操作符"."或"[]"来获取嵌套表格(table)元素。嵌套表格是指表格中的元素也是表格的情况。

以下是获取嵌套表格元素的示例代码:

代码语言:txt
复制
-- 创建一个嵌套表格
local nestedTable = {
    key1 = "value1",
    key2 = {
        subKey1 = "subValue1",
        subKey2 = "subValue2"
    }
}

-- 使用"."操作符获取嵌套表格元素
local value1 = nestedTable.key1
local subValue1 = nestedTable.key2.subKey1

-- 使用"[]"操作符获取嵌套表格元素
local value2 = nestedTable["key1"]
local subValue2 = nestedTable["key2"]["subKey1"]

在上述示例中,我们首先创建了一个嵌套表格nestedTable,其中包含了两个键值对。然后,我们使用.操作符和[]操作符分别获取了嵌套表格中的元素。

对于嵌套表格元素的获取,需要按照层级关系逐级访问。例如,nestedTable.key2.subKey1表示获取nestedTablekey2表格中的subKey1元素。

Lua中的表格是一种非常灵活和强大的数据结构,可以用于表示数组、字典、对象等各种数据形式。在实际开发中,嵌套表格常用于组织复杂的数据结构,例如配置文件、游戏场景等。

对于Lua的云计算相关应用场景,腾讯云提供了云服务器CVM、云函数SCF、云数据库MySQL、云存储COS等产品,可以满足不同规模和需求的云计算场景。具体产品介绍和相关链接可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券